Govt moves toward consensus on GM Corn commercialization framework

August 31, 2026 (MLN):  The Committee on Genetically Modified (GM) Corn has agreed to finalize a comprehensive transition and implementation framework for the commercialization of genetically modified maize in Pakistan, with the government stating that the exercise would move beyond policy formulation into actual implementation and transition.

The framework centres on the principle of coexistence between GM and non-GM maize, in line with the approved National Agricultural Biotechnology Policy, with the transition set to take place gradually to allow stakeholders time to adapt, while ensuring continuity in the supply of non-GM seed without unnecessary price escalation.

The Committee, constituted by the Prime Minister to conduct an objective, scientific-based and evidence-driven review of Pakistan's GM maize commercialization policy, was chaired by Federal Minister for Finance and Revenue Senator Muhammad Aurangzeb.

The meeting reviewed progress made through stakeholder consultations and discussed the proposed implementation and transition framework, said a press release issued.

It was attended by the Secretary of the Ministry of National Food Security & Research, the Coordinator to the Prime Minister on Agriculture and Food Security, the CEO of Pakistan Green Initiative, and representatives of relevant business and export sectors, along with technical and scientific experts.

Participants discussed concerns raised by industry members over the transition period, availability of non-GM seed and potential implications for existing industry players, and stressed the need for a practical, well-defined framework addressing the concerns of all stakeholders while remaining aligned with national interest.

The Committee called for a comprehensive implementation framework with appropriate safeguards and clear guidelines to ensure effective coexistence of GM and non-GM maize, incorporating input from the seed industry, maize millers, academia and technical experts.

Senator Aurangzeb emphasized the importance of setting realistic timelines while avoiding unnecessary delays, so that the agreed framework could be translated into action.

The Committee also took up the issue of technology adoption and modern agricultural practices, including improvements in harvesting, storage and related infrastructure, to support productivity gains across Pakistan's agriculture sector.

The finance minister acknowledged the contributions of all members and stakeholders, noting that the Committee had moved from differing positions toward a broad consensus on the way forward, and said the eventual recommendations should serve the national interest while safeguarding the concerns of relevant stakeholders.

He directed that the process be completed expeditiously so the recommendations could be taken forward for implementation by the concerned authorities.
